Macronutrients and Vitamins in "Jews Ear"
Food Name: Jews Ear | |
Food Group: Vegetables | |
Macronutrients | |
Calories (kcal): 25 | Carbohydrates (g): 7 |
Net Carbs (g): 7 | Water (g): 93 |
Vitamins | |
Vitamin C (mg): 1 | Pantothenic Acid/B5 (mg): 2 |
Folate/B9 (mcg): 19 | Food Folate (mcg): 19 |
Folate DFE (mcg): 19 | |
Minerals | |
Calcium (mg): 16 | Iron (mg): 1 |
Magnesium (mg): 25 | Phosphorus (mg): 14 |
Potassium (mg): 43 | Sodium (mg): 9 |
Zinc (mg): 1 | Selenium (mcg): 11 |
Other Compounds | |
PRAL Score: -1 |

What are the protein, carbohydrate, and fat contents in 100 grams of 'Jews Ear'?
100 grams of 'Jews Ear' contains approximately following amounts of protein, carbohydrates, and fat:
Protein – 0g (around 0% of daily requirement),
Carbohydrates – 7g (around 3% of daily requirement),
Fat – 0g (around 0% of daily requirement).
It is typically higher in Carbohydrates while lower in Fat, making it more suitable for diets that are high-carb and also suitable for those requiring low Fat intake.
How many calories are in 100 grams of 'Jews Ear'?
A 100-gram serving of 'Jews Ear' provides around 25 kcal of energy. The majority of the calories come from carbohydrates, based on its macronutrient composition. This contributes approximately 1% of an average 2000 kcal daily diet, making it a low-calorie food choice.
Is 'Jews Ear' mainly a source of protein, carbohydrates, or fat?
In 100g, 'Jews Ear' is mainly a source of carbohydrates. It contains 0g protein, 7g carbs, and 0g fat, making it suitable for diets focused on carbohydrates.
